How To Choose The Best Cables And Connectors For Your Shure Beta 87A

Choosing the right cables and connectors for your Shure Beta 87A microphone is essential to ensure optimal sound quality and durability. The Beta 87A is a professional-grade condenser microphone that requires careful selection of accessories to match its performance standards.

Understanding Your Shure Beta 87A

The Shure Beta 87A is known for its smooth, wide frequency response and excellent rejection of background noise. To preserve these qualities, it’s important to use high-quality cables and connectors that do not introduce noise or signal loss.

Types of Cables Suitable for the Beta 87A

  • XLR Cables: The most recommended option for professional use. They provide balanced audio signals that reduce noise and interference.

Features to Look for in Cables

  • Shielding: Choose cables with good shielding to prevent electromagnetic interference.
  • Durability: Look for cables with reinforced connectors and robust insulation.
  • Length: Use the shortest cable necessary to reduce signal degradation.

Choosing the Right Connectors

The Beta 87A typically uses an XLR connector for professional audio setups. Ensuring compatibility and quality of connectors is crucial for maintaining sound integrity.

XLR Connectors

Opt for high-quality XLR connectors made from durable materials like metal. Gold-plated contacts can provide better conductivity and resistance to corrosion.

Connector Compatibility

Verify that the connectors are compatible with your audio interface or mixer. Most professional setups use standard XLR connections, but it’s important to check specifications.

Additional Tips for Optimal Performance

  • Regularly inspect cables and connectors for wear and damage.
  • Avoid bending cables sharply or pulling on connectors.
  • Use cable ties or clips to organize cables and prevent accidental damage.
  • Store cables in a cool, dry place when not in use.
